How much battery drain is normal in one hour?

It heavily depends on usage, but usually a healthy battery should not really drain more then 15% (20% MAX) in 1 hour. If you seem to be wasting like 30% or more in a single hour regardless of what you do, then that means your battery is at the verge of needing to be replaced, if not already needing it at this point.

How much battery drain is normal overnight?

It is absolutely normal for a phone's battery to drain by 10% overnight. It happens due to all the background processes going on in the phone. If you really want to save battery, then you must turn on airplane mode, and block the background processes before you go to sleep.

Does dark mode save battery?

Surprisingly enough, findings from the study reveal that dark mode is unlikely to impact the battery life of a smartphone significantly. Though it does use less battery than a regular light-coloured theme, the difference is unlikely to be noticeable “with the way that most people use their phones on a daily basis. “

How do I know if my battery is healthy?

Open the phone app and enter *#*#4636#*#*. This will open a “Testing” menu that may include a “Battery information” section. You'll see the battery health listed here.

How long should a phone battery last?

Cell phone batteries last an average of 3 to 5 years, but that estimate can vary greatly depending on different factors. Charging habits play a major role in a battery's lifespan. The more you charge the battery, the more its capacity will diminish over time.

How do I keep my phone battery healthy?

Store it half-charged when you store it long term.
  1. Do not fully charge or fully discharge your device's battery — charge it to around 50%. ...
  2. Power down the device to avoid additional battery use.
  3. Place your device in a cool, moisture-free environment that's less than 90° F (32° C).

What makes a battery last longer?

Firstly and most importantly, reduce the load: close apps, turn off Wi-Fi and GPS, lower screen brightness, etc. And secondly, keep your device in a warm (but not hot) place. A warmer battery allows the chemical reactions to take place more easily, thereby unlocking a little bit of extra energy.

When should I charge my phone battery?

When should I charge my phone? The golden rule is to keep your battery topped up somewhere between 30% and 90% most of the time. Top it up when it drops below 50%, but unplug it before it hits 100%. For this reason, you might want to reconsider leaving it plugged in overnight.

Does fast charging drain battery faster?

No, quick charge doesn't led to fast drainage of battery. Quick charging just supplies the charging mechanism for the battery with more power, it doesn't change the way the battery itself works or how the power is stored in the cells. It also doesn't change the way the power discharges from the battery.
